Wilma Davis Obituary

Wilma Jean Freeman Davis, 88 of Clarksburg passed away on Saturday, September 05, 2020 at Meadowview Manor. She was born November 06, 1931 in Moatsville, daughter of the late Ira Delbert and Marguerite Jane Cline Freeman.

Wilma graduated from Kasson High School and attended WV Business College. She worked for Information & Referral Service which became Criss Cross Inc as an administrative assistant from which she retired.  She attended Clarksburg Baptist Church where she taught Sunday school for many years. She had very strong Christian values and loved to sing about her Savior. Wilma was very active with the Boy Scouts and Cub Scouts and was known as “Mom” at Camp Mahonegon. Wilma was also mom and mammaw to not just her children and grandchildren but many of their friends as well.
